Best Selling Products
-
Knight Templars Beauseant Flag 11" W x 7.25" T Embroidered Iron or Sew-on Patch Supply0 out of 5
$119.00$47.60
Latest Products
Top Rated products
-
Knight Templars Beauseant Flag 11" W x 7.25" T Embroidered Iron or Sew-on Patch Supply0 out of 5
$119.00$47.60